Management Meeting Minutes — Reseller Programme

Present: Dena Forsgate, Ollie Rennick, Priya Calloway.

Quick recap: the Fernlight reseller programme is tracking ahead of plan — 14 partners signed versus the 10 we'd hoped for. Margins are a bit thinner than modelled, mostly down to the tiered discount we offered early joiners. Ollie will tighten the discount bands before the next intake. Where we want to take the programme next is covered in the note below.

board note of yahip-tadug: Headcount on the Zorath team goes from 9 to 100 by the end of April. Gross margin on Zorath came in at 10 percent against a plan of 20 percent.

Facilities Ticket — Cleaning Crew Access, Brindle Annex

For new starters handling evening lock-up: the Sorano Cleaning crew arrives nightly at 21:30 via the annex side door. Check their rota sheet, note arrival in the log, and ensure the storeroom is relocked afterward. To let them through the side door, enter the access code below.

badge for yaweg-hafog: bdg-GX-6

Ticket: IMP-882 — Expired credential for CSV import wizard staging

The service credential that the Quillgate CSV import wizard uses to reach the Harrowby validation service lapsed over the weekend, which is why every staged import is failing at the schema-check step. This blocks the release candidate cut scheduled for Thursday. A fresh credential has been issued with identical scopes; no code changes are required beyond swapping the value in the release config. The replacement key is below.

service key, tadup-tahog: zpat7_wB1tnEL

Beyond 40x, ingredient rounding compounds badly:
 * leavening and salt drift out of proportion and users get inedible results.
 * If you're on call and see ScaleLimitExceeded errors spiking, it's almost
 * always a batch-import job passing raw serving counts instead of ratios.
 * Do not raise this constant without sign-off from the kitchen-math group;
 * lower it temporarily if needed. For incident reports, include the build
 * token that appears on the next line.
 */

session token of kahif-kageg = htk14_01cd78718aea51